We have an exciting opportunity for a Specialist Speech and Language Therapist to work with adults with learning disabilities in the Cambridgeshire Learning Disability Partnership (LDP). The LDP comprises five locality-based integrated community specialist health and care management teams (social workers, care co-ordinators, psychiatrists and occupational, arts, and speech & language therapists) and day and accommodation services organised by the Local Authority for adults with a learning disability. Healthcare practitioners are employed by Cambridgeshire & Peterborough NHS Foundation Trust but work within the LDP. The SLT service comprises a Lead Speech and Language Therapist, two Advanced SLTs, two Specialist SLTs plus an Assistant SLT, all employed by CPFT. We have close links with colleagues working with people with learning disabilities elsewhere in CPFT and with clinicians and/or researchers at the University of East Anglia (UEA) and the Department of Psychiatry, University of Cambridge.   • To participate in the delivery of countywide specialist LD Speech and Language Therapy by managing a team caseload of clients with complex learning disabilities.
  • To provide professional supervision to other staff /students as appropriate including appraisal and professional development, particularly mandatory training.
  • To contribute to the planning, development, and evaluation of learning disability services, including contributing to defined projects as delegated by the LDP management team.
  • As an autonomous practitioner, to manage a specialist case load providing assessment, identification and treatment of communication and swallowing needs of adults with a learning disability.
  • To participate in multi-disciplinary/ multi agency working within the LDP and with Key partners.
